Transaction dfd3e3e87b70aa7d792951cce74a2ccd61150611006765603a48b416f5917912

13 Input
2 Outputs
  • dfd3e3e87b70aa7d792951cce74a2ccd61150611006765603a48b416f5917912:0
  • value  1974051453
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• dfd3e3e87b70aa7d792951cce74a2ccd61150611006765603a48b416f5917912:1
  • value  1158844572
    address  3EHM7t7hKKQ2FGRq7TJBGXh9zJbjaYBPzY